Analysis
The most recent figure for teachers in upper secondary education, both sexes in Cook Islands is 100, measured in 2024.
The figure is down 2.9% on the previous year and up 13.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, teachers in upper secondary education, both sexes in Cook Islands peaked at 103 in 2023 and was at its lowest, 80.19, in 2021.
Cook Islands ranks 147th of 154 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
Teachers in upper secondary education, both sexes in Cook Islands,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 86.08 | — |
| 2011 | 95.64 | +11.1% |
| 2012 | 88.29 | -7.7% |
| 2021 | 80.19 | -9.2% |
| 2022 | 90.49 | +12.8% |
| 2023 | 103 | +13.8% |
| 2024 | 100 | -2.9% |
